What affects the price

The final bill for septic work depends on a few specific variables. First, the size of your tank and the total volume of waste removal play a role. We also look at the accessibility of your tank lids; if they are buried deep underground or hidden under landscaping, extra labor is required to reach them. The distance from our truck to the tank also impacts the setup time. Every property has unique plumbing needs, and exact pricing is confirmed free on the call.

About this service

A septic inspection involves a licensed professional assessing the health of your onsite wastewater system. They look for signs of backups, check the drain field for saturated or swampy areas, and verify that the tank is at the correct liquid level. This is a smart move if your toilets are flushing slowly or if you notice strange odors in your yard. Getting an expert to look at the system annually helps you avoid major, costly failures down the road.

What is involved in septic tank drain field maintenance in Fresno?

Septic tank drain field maintenance in Fresno involves ensuring proper distribution of effluent and preventing soil compaction. This includes regular septic tank pumping to avoid overloading the drain field with solids. It also means being mindful of what is flushed down drains and avoiding driving or parking heavy vehicles over the drain field area. Proper care extends its lifespan significantly.

What does septic cleaning entail for Fresno homeowners?

Septic cleaning for Fresno homeowners involves pumping out the accumulated sludge and scum from the septic tank using a specialized vacuum truck. After pumping, the tank may be inspected for any signs of damage or blockages. Regular cleaning is essential to prevent the solids from reaching and damaging the drain field, ensuring the system's longevity and efficient operation. It's a vital preventative measure.
